994. Deputy Marian Harkin asked the Minister for Transport, Tourism and Sport if he will consider State support to a company (details supplied) due to the Covid-19 crisis and in the context of the almost complete shutdown of the aviation industry. [5952/20]

My Department is continuing to monitor the financial impact that the COVID-19 pandemic is having on the aviation sector.

Some measures have already been put in place by the Government such as the wage subsidy scheme and unemployment benefits to support industries, including aviation, in these difficult times. Many EU Governments have already stepped in to provide specific support for airlines. It is not evident at this stage that, other than the general business supports that are available in Ireland, that the need for further immediate support is necessary for the Irish industry. Any Government support for airlines would have to be clearly justified by reference to strategic interests.
